(10 points) Write a program that takes three inputs from the prompt (Hint: You may call the prompt function 3 times in the program).
a. If the sum of the three inputs is more than 10, use a for loop to print the sum of the three numbers for 10 times.
b. If the sum of the three inputs is less than or equal to 10, use a while loop to print the product of the three numbers for 5 times.
(10 points) Write a program that takes three inputs from the prompt the same as the first question.
a. Write an arrow function called "loopSum" that takes three numbers as arguments. The function uses a for loop to print the sum of the three numbers for 10 times.
